What is 5G Technology?

5G stands for the fifth generation of mobile networks, succeeding the previous generations (4G, 3G, etc.). It is designed to meet the growing demand for data connectivity, aimed at providing faster download speeds, improved responsiveness, and a more reliable connection.

Key Features of 5G Networks

  • Speed: 5G technology can deliver download speeds up to 100 times faster than 4G, allowing for quick streaming, downloads, and real-time data transfer.
  • Low Latency: With latency as low as 1 millisecond, 5G reduces the delay between sending and receiving data, enhancing experiences in gaming and virtual reality.
  • More Devices Connected: 5G can support up to 1 million devices per square kilometer, making it ideal for smart cities and IoT applications.

The Global 5G Landscape

As the 5G technology rollout progresses, different countries are at various stages of implementation. Nations like South Korea and China are leading the way, while others are still laying the groundwork. Telecommunications companies are investing heavily in infrastructure to ensure widespread coverage, but challenges remain, including regulatory hurdles and the need for new hardware.

What is 5G Technology?

5G stands for “fifth generation” and is the latest advancement in mobile network technology. Designed to meet the ever-increasing demand for data, 5G is capable of delivering multi-gigabit speeds and supports a larger number of devices with minimal interruptions. This technology utilizes a combination of frequency bands – low, mid, and high-band (millimeter waves) – to optimize performance based on the specific needs of users.

Key Benefits of 5G Networks

  • Faster Speeds: Enjoy download speeds that can exceed 10 Gbps in ideal conditions, making file transfers seamless.
  • Low Latency: Experience reduced latency (as low as 1 millisecond), which is crucial for real-time applications like gaming, VR, and autonomous vehicles.
  • Enhanced Connectivity: 5G can connect up to a million devices per square kilometer, enabling smart cities and IoT applications.
  • Improved Reliability: Enjoy a consistent and reliable connection, minimizing interruptions and dropped signals.
  • Greater Capacity: Increased capacity to support a growing number of devices and users without sacrificing performance.
